15. Adjustments for circuit parameters
are given in this Circuit Options panel. Each item has a default
value, which may be changed easily or reset to the default value.
The Frequency List, for example, has mid-band frequencies for
each of the ten ham bands (including the proposed 60-meter band),
but you may wish to specify a different value for the edge of
a band. You may save and recall an unlimited number of frequency
lists.
In a similar way, typical Required SNR values and bandwidths
are shown for each of five Service Types, but you may wish to
specify different values.
Starting with Version 2, the user
may now select the more conservative VOACAP standard Required
SNR values. Or, DX/Contest defaults may be used by the more experienced
ham operator in contest situations.
Man-made Noise Levels are similarly specified in the right-hand
panel. This screen also permits the user to decide whether the
Sporadic-E (Es) ionospheric layer is to be included in the propagation
calculations. Shutting off the Es calculation will result in
more conservative predictions. Invoking the Es computation will
cause the letters "Es" to appear in the circuit and
area coverage comment lines, and in the Main Chart and Area Coverage
ID lines. |
